Advertisement

solvey_案例14导纳矩阵_matlab_matpower_节点导纳矩阵_源码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供了使用MATLAB和MATPOWER工具箱计算电力系统节点导纳矩阵的实例代码。通过解决案例14,帮助用户掌握导纳矩阵生成及应用技巧。 用MATLAB求解Matpower中的case14及之前案例的节点导纳矩阵。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• solvey_14_matlab_matpower__
    优质
    本资源提供了使用MATLAB和MATPOWER工具箱计算电力系统节点导纳矩阵的实例代码。通过解决案例14,帮助用户掌握导纳矩阵生成及应用技巧。 用MATLAB求解Matpower中的case14及之前案例的节点导纳矩阵。
  • IEEE39计算数据.zip___IEEE39
    优质
    这是一个包含IEEE 39节点系统的导纳矩阵的数据包。文件提供了用于电力系统分析和研究所需的详细网络连接信息,适用于学术及工程应用。 计算电力系统节点导纳矩阵的方法适用于任何节点,并可以使用IEEE39节点数据进行通用计算。
  • 组抗总结
    优质
    本文综述了电力系统分析中的两个关键概念——节点导纳矩阵与节点阻抗矩阵,探讨其定义、特性及应用,并总结两者之间的关系。 本段落总结了节点导纳矩阵与节点阻抗矩阵的关系,并阐述了它们之间的可逆性。文章还介绍了节点组抗矩阵的形成过程,并证明了节点阻抗矩阵具有对称性的特点。
  • MATLAB中生成
    优质
    本简介介绍如何在MATLAB环境下编程生成电力系统中的节点导纳矩阵,涵盖基本原理和代码实现。 下面是经过优化的 MATLAB 函数代码: ```matlab function Y = CreateY(branchData) if nargin < 1 % 如果输入参数不足,则使用默认数据生成函数来提供分支数据。 branchData = InputData(); end busf = branchData(:,1); % 分支起点节点编号 bust = branchData(:,2); % 分支终点节点编号 z = branchData(:,3); % 支路阻抗 branchCount = length(busf); busCount = max([busf, bust]); % 确定总的节点数量 Y = zeros(busCount); % 初始化导纳矩阵为全零矩阵,大小与总节点数一致。 for n = 1:branchCount Y(busf(n),bust(n)) = Y(busf(n),bust(n))-1/z(n); Y(bust(n),busf(n)) = Y(busf(n),bust(n)); % 更新起点和终点节点的自导纳值。 Y(busf(n),busf(n)) = Y(busf(n),busf(n))+1/z(n); Y(bust(n),bust(n)) = Y(bust(n),bust(n))+1/z(n); end end ``` 这段代码的主要功能是根据给定的支路数据(包括起点、终点和阻抗)来创建一个导纳矩阵 `Y`。如果函数调用时没有提供输入参数,则会自动使用默认的数据生成方法来获取必要的分支信息,以完成整个计算过程。
  • MATLAB生成的代
    优质
    本段落介绍了一种使用MATLAB编程语言来生成电力系统中节点导纳矩阵的高效代码。该方法适用于电网分析与设计中的复杂计算任务。 编写一个形成Matlab中节点导纳矩阵的程序可以帮助大家更好地理解导纳矩阵的生成过程。
  • MATLAB生成的代
    优质
    本段代码用于在MATLAB环境中自动生成电力系统节点导纳矩阵,适用于电网分析与仿真,简化了复杂网络模型的手工建模过程。 编写一个形成MATLAB中节点导纳矩阵的程序可以帮助大家更好地理解导纳矩阵的构建过程。
  • 程序
    优质
    导纳矩阵程序是一种用于电力系统分析和计算的软件工具,通过构建电网元件之间的电气关系模型,评估网络性能、稳定性及优化资源配置。 以前的一个作业是用MATLAB编写节点导纳矩阵。
  • Case 14: IEEE14系统的潮流计算与文件)
    优质
    本案例文件聚焦于IEEE14节点系统中的潮流计算及其节点导纳矩阵的应用分析,旨在深入探讨电力系统稳态运行特性。 IEEE14节点系统的潮流计算能够得出以下结果:系统节点导纳矩阵、所有节点的类型、各节点电压幅值及相角、各节点消耗的有功功率与无功功率,以及发电机节点发出的有功功率和无功功率及其总容量。
  • 基于Matlab的算法
    优质
    本研究利用Matlab开发了一种高效的节点导纳矩阵计算算法,旨在提高电力系统分析中的计算效率和准确性。 在电力系统的潮流计算过程中,首先需要计算节点导纳矩阵。这里可以使用Matlab来实现这一过程。
  • Matlab中的实现.txt
    优质
    本文档详细介绍了在MATLAB环境中如何构建和操作电力系统中的节点导纳矩阵,包括其原理、计算方法及应用示例。 节点导纳矩阵是用于表示电路中电压与电流关系的一种矩阵形式。在电路分析过程中,Kirchhoff定律描述了各节点间电压和电流的关系。而节点导纳矩阵则提供了一种简洁且方便的方式来表达这些关系。 具体而言,每个元素代表两个特定节点之间的电导(即当存在电压差时通过这两个节点的电流)。利用这种表示方式可以求解电路中的各个节点电压或电流的具体数值,这取决于分析的具体需求。在MATLAB中使用该矩阵进行计算具有以下优势: 1. **高效的矩阵运算**:由于专门设计用于处理矩阵操作,MATLAB能够轻松执行诸如乘法和逆运算等常见于电路分析的操作。 2. **数据可视化工具的利用**:通过提供丰富的绘图选项,MATLAB有助于更直观地理解并解释分析结果。 3. **自动化与重复性**:允许用户编写脚本以自动完成大规模或复杂度较高的仿真任务,提高了工作效率和一致性。 4. **模块化编程支持**:鼓励开发可重用的代码片段来构建复杂的电路模型,便于维护及后续修改工作。 5. **良好的互操作性**:能够与其他软件工具(如Simulink)无缝集成,使得整个系统的建模与仿真流程更加顺畅。 综上所述,在MATLAB环境中应用节点导纳矩阵可以实现高效、直观且灵活的电力系统分析。